Cell-based seafood maker BlueNalu says it might probably make a 75% gross revenue in its first yr of manufacturing cultivated bluefin tuna toro when it operates at scale in its deliberate business facility.
It should take a while for the corporate to get there. Lou Cooperhouse, co-founder, president and CEO, estimates that the business facility will start manufacturing in 2027, and BlueNalu must obtain approval from the FDA to have the ability to make cultivated meat for common consumption. However, in accordance with a latest techno-economic evaluation wanting on the firm’s full value and final result perspective, they will attain that revenue margin with tuna grown from cells that’s offered on the identical value as that coming from fish.
“That gross margin could be very achievable and attainable at value parity,” Cooperhouse mentioned.
This sort of breakthrough has been central to the mission of BlueNalu from the start, Cooperhouse mentioned. The corporate was not based to show that cell-cultured seafood might be made, he mentioned. As a substitute, it was based to seek out areas available in the market the place cell-cultured seafood may make a distinction — rising entry to sought-after premium seafood merchandise which are sustainable, freed from environmental contaminants, and are available from a predictable provide chain with constant costs.
“The corporate was actually based not on proof of idea, however proof of scale — and the way we will determine methodologies that will finally allow large-scale manufacturing,” he mentioned.
BlueNalu’s deliberate business facility, which Cooperhouse mentioned they’re on the very starting phases of planning, will be capable of produce as much as 6 million kilos of seafood a yr, the corporate says. It is going to be about 140,000 sq. toes, with eight 100,000-liter bioreactors. And the corporate’s latest breakthroughs will facilitate this degree of effectivity and profitability, mentioned Chief Know-how Officer Lauran Madden.
Extra cells, much less time
A improvement Madden mentioned is vital to reaching that top profitability margin is its improvement of cells that may develop in a single-cell suspension, fully on their very own in a bioreactor, Madden mentioned.
Cells that may develop on their very own can develop higher with fewer processing steps, higher toleration of strain from all sides and simpler transitions between rising vessel sizes, she mentioned. There is no such thing as a concern about clusters of cells that have to be damaged aside. And there’s no want for microcarriers, that are small balls positioned in a bioreactor that present surfaces for cells to develop on. With these cells, every bioreactor has the capability produce extra muscle cells.

BlueNalu’s cells are all non-GMO, so that they weren’t altered in any option to make them develop in suspension. Madden mentioned that is the results of a number of work discovering the suitable cells and the suitable processes. BlueNalu works with a number of completely different cell strains, she mentioned.
“I consider it a bit of bit as like Olympic trials, the place you will have a number of contestants and you utilize completely different applied sciences to evaluate” how they carry out in numerous environments and processes to get the habits and observable traits that you really want, Madden mentioned.
A brand new strategy to a seafood delicacy
Bluefin tuna toro, the fatty stomach portion of the fish, is what BlueNalu is growing as its first product.
Whereas the corporate had beforehand mentioned it could first make cultivated mahi-mahi, Cooperhouse mentioned conversations with cooks and worldwide distribution partnerships led them to deal with the tuna delicacy. Whereas mahi-mahi is in style in america, it’s not as wanted in Asia or Europe, the place BlueNalu has distribution and advertising and marketing partnerships. Bluefin tuna toro is in style in all places, Cooperhouse mentioned, and the potential of a gradual cultivated provide of the meat excited cooks.
And there’s another excuse it’s an excellent first product: It offers BlueNalu an opportunity to point out off its expertise, Cooperhouse mentioned. Madden defined that to make manufacturing as environment friendly as attainable, BlueNalu desires to have the ability to use only one cell sort to make the fatty tuna stomach. And to try this with out having to individually develop fats cells, they developed “lipid loading,” which provides fat and different lipids on to the muscle cells. Madden mentioned this helps recreate the precise dietary profile of bluefin tuna toro from an animal, with omega-3s and saturated and unsaturated fatty acids.
Bluefin tuna toro is exclusive, and Cooperhouse mentioned their cultivated product will present that BlueNalu is working to genuinely recreate what folks love about seafood.
“[It is] a really excessive sensory product that we’re excited to carry ahead as our demonstration, our dedication to actually scrumptious, nice tasting seafood,” he mentioned.
To develop merchandise after the cells develop, BlueNalu presently is just not utilizing scaffolds — buildings on which cells develop into codecs just like meat customers are accustomed to. Madden mentioned they’re taking the cells and utilizing a course of just like extrusion to create them in a type that buyers are used to. The merchandise BlueNalu is growing are 100% cultivated cells and don’t have any further parts.
Extra swimming to go
Whereas these bulletins are excellent news for BlueNalu, the corporate must get regulatory approval for its cultivated seafood from FDA with the intention to even get shut to creating any earnings. BlueNalu has been working with federal regulators for 3 years, Cooperhouse mentioned, and he feels good in regards to the progress that has been made. There are not any printed regulatory requirements for cultivated meat or seafood to this point in america, and no cultivated meat corporations have obtained the inexperienced gentle but.

BlueNalu can also be pursuing regulatory approval in a number of different international locations, together with nations in Asia, Europe and the Center East, Cooperhouse mentioned. The corporate is just not presently engaged on manufacturing services in different international locations, however has preliminary plans to export its seafood to different nations the place it may be offered.
There’s additionally a matter of services. BlueNalu simply moved into its Southern California 38,000-square-foot pilot facility and innovation middle earlier this yr. Cooperhouse mentioned that is supposed to be the place it develops and optimizes new merchandise, however it might probably produce a small quantity of product. Precise website choice and work on the commercial-scale facility will come within the subsequent couple of years.
BlueNalu has developed cell strains for eight completely different species of fin fish, and Cooperhouse mentioned they’ve large plans to vary the superb seafood market.
“Our purpose is to finally allow [restaurant operators] to displace as many [traditionally fished] merchandise as attainable, and make many extra purposes from our bluefin tuna and different species to observe on these menus,” he mentioned. “It is all about that premium meals service resolution that we’re actually concentrating on right here.”
